Output 64e783f4733db8a28d4e40f633e4a7e84bbd2389dbdeb7ff2d3b14de97417741:1

value
263864386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a890937d85c834c18c64996378c1aa13ba02ce OP_EQUAL
address
32CwEb1FhinmdnJK321KFpisqrbaV2xLE5
transaction
64e783f4733db8a28d4e40f633e4a7e84bbd2389dbdeb7ff2d3b14de97417741
confirmations
438452
spent
true